Due to Chinese housing reform and increasing house demand, these years have witnessed great development of residential mortgage since 1998. The data show that the average annual growth rate reaches 84% from 1998 to 2004, much higher than that of all RMB loan in financial institutions. Besides, up to April 2005 the mortgage balance has attained as much as RMB 1674.37 billion. As a crucial part of banking transactions, residential mortgage assists in diversifying bank transactions, increasing bank profit and lowering bank risks. However, residential mortgage is vulnerable to the fluctuation of house price and debtors' revenue, which will induce risks to the whole banking.
